Chanting 'Long live Palestine' as they marched up Broadway, signs held aloft while waving the tri-color flag of Palestine, the marchers were part of a protest aimed at persuading elected leaders to press for a ceasefire and an end to what they called the Israeli occupation, said Sarah Farouq, community organizer with the San Diego for Palestine Coalition.
Palestinian militants, in turn have retaliated with fire rockets into Israel. The fallout from the Hamas attack continues to grow, with the death toll of those in Gaza estimated to be more than 4,300. Signs and chants of the demonstrators Saturday attested to their fears and frustrations over the daily battles in Israel — 'Free Palestine,' 'Your tax dollars kill children,' 'Stop funding genocide.' Farouq emphasized that the downtown march was not meant to be anti-Israeli.
